OVERVIEW


The Junior HR & Office Coordinator’s primary purpose is to effectively assist the office and employees through greeting and assisting all on-site visitors, handling all in-coming phone calls, efficiently managing supply inventory, facilities, and vendors, planning internal events and meetings, assisting with People Success duties, and other office related projects/duties as assigned.

MAIN DUTIES

    • Support global HR administrative tasks, including data entry, document preparation, and HR task coordination.
    • Coordinate travel arrangements, lead onboarding processes for new employees, and manage tasks in Workday.
    • Oversee incoming shipments and ensure timely organization of outgoing mail and shipping.
    • Supervise and maintain office equipment, taking the lead in vendor management and maintenance.
    • Manage inventory for office, kitchen, and shipping supplies, and collaborate with building management to ensure facility maintenance and adherence to safety protocols.
    • Act as the primary point of contact for office visitors, ensuring a welcoming reception area and handling incoming calls with professionalism.
